    Description / Table of Contents: (-)-(1R,2R,5S)-trans-Pinane-1,10-diol and (+)-(1R,2S,5S)-trans-Pinan-1-ol, Two Pinane Derivatives Containing a Functional Group at the BridgeheadTreatment of (-)-P-pinene (1) with triisobutylaluminium (2) followed by oxidation with oxygen and hydrolysis yields (-)-trans-myrtanol (6) and the by-product trans-pinane-1, 10-diol (9). The latter, which is the first pinane derivative found to contain a functional group at the C1 bridgehead, may be easily converted into (-)-trans-pinan-1-ol (11).
